17 Sep 2012 6:11 AM #1
Unanswered: Lazy loaded tree of many models
I am writing an application using the MVC approach of ExtJS 4.1.
- The application will have three panels, a header panel (North), a Navigation tree panel (West), and Main Forms Panel (Center).
- The header panel contains a combo box where a user can select a business.
- The selection of a business should trigger the navigation tree panel to be loaded with the business as the root.
- Clicking on Vendors, Customers or Categories should lazy load the relevant entities, and so on down the tree.
Product 3ProductLine B
Product 5ProductLine C
ProductsProduct 6Vendor B
- I then want to add Create, Review, Update and Delete (CRUD) functionality to the tree, so that I can fully manage the business entities.
- Each different type of entity within the business tree will have a different model so I will need to be able display the relevant form /view for that enity.
- Ideally the tree should automatically reflect all of the CRUD changes, and keep its state (i.e. if nodes are expanded or selected, they should remain so.)
24 Sep 2012 7:09 AM #2
- Join Date
- Mar 2007
- Gainesville, FL
- Vote Rating
What have you gotten working thus far?Mitchell Simoens @LikelyMitch
Sencha Inc, Senior Software Engineer
Check out my GitHub, lots of nice things for Ext JS 4 and Sencha Touch 2
Think my support is good? Get more personalized support via a support subscription. https://www.sencha.com/store/
Need more help with your app? Hire Sencha Services firstname.lastname@example.org
Want to learn Sencha Touch 2? Check out Sencha Touch in Action that is in print!
When posting code, please use BBCode's CODE tags.